TROUBLESHOOTING AND ELECTRICAL SYSTEM: DIESEL VEHICLES
TEST PROCEDURE 14 – NEUTRAL SWITCH (TRANSMISSION)
See General Warning, Section 1, Page 1-1.
The neutral switch is located on the transmission housing.
1. Turn the key switch OFF and remove the key. Place the Forward/Reverse handle in NEUTRAL. Chock
the wheels.
2. Disconnect the battery cables as instructed. See WARNING "To avoid unintentionally starting..." in
General Warning, Section 1, Page 1-1.
3. Disconnect the two-pin connector between the neutral switch and the wire harness (w143 and w142)
(Figure 11c-26, Page 11c-32).
4. Check for continuity on the switch contacts with the Forward/Reverse handle in the FORWARD position
(Figure 11c-31, Page 11c-35). The multimeter should indicate no continuity.
5. Check for continuity on the switch contacts with the Forward/Reverse handle in the NEUTRAL position
(Figure 11c-32, Page 11c-36). The multimeter should indicate continuity.
6. Check for continuity on the switch contacts with the Forward/Reverse handle in the REVERSE position
(Figure 11c-33, Page 11c-36). The multimeter should indicate no continuity.
7. If any of the continuity readings are incorrect, replace the neutral switch. See Neutral Switch Removal,
Section 12c, Page 12c-2.
